Percy Tau, the South African international and one of the most prominent footballers to emerge from Mzansi in recent years, has reportedly arrived in Qatar ahead of his next big move. After months of speculation regarding his future, the forward is now set to take the next step in his career, with reports indicating that he will undergo a medical ahead of a potential transfer to a top club in the Qatar Stars League.
Tau, who has enjoyed a career filled with international experience in countries such as Belgium, England, and Egypt, has been a key player for both club and country. After leaving Al Ahly, where he played under renowned coach Pitso Mosimane, the 29-year-old has attracted interest from various clubs across the Middle East, with Qatar emerging as a likely destination.
Sources close to the player have confirmed that Tau landed in Qatar earlier this week, and the next steps are now in place for him to finalize his move. Reports suggest that Tau is set to undergo a medical examination on Thursday, 11 January 2025, with the goal of ensuring his fitness ahead of signing a deal with his new club. While the name of the specific team has not been disclosed, insiders have indicated that a leading Qatari side is keen to secure Tauβs services for the remainder of the season, with the potential for a longer-term commitment if the deal goes through smoothly.
Percy Tauβs move to Qatar would mark another chapter in his career after a series of successful stints in top African and European leagues. His time at Al Ahly was particularly fruitful, where he was part of a team that dominated Egyptian football and regularly competed in CAF Champions League tournaments. However, following a challenging period under new management and changes in the squad, Tauβs future at the club became uncertain, leading to his decision to seek new opportunities.
